Mexican Mice Recipe
- 2 sticks (1 cup) butter, softened
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½ cup confectioners’ sugar, plus more for dusting
- 2 cups flour
- 1 cup finely ground pecans
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- Chow mein noodles
- Mini-chocolate chips
- Sliced almonds
- Heat oven to 350 degrees. Beat butter and vanilla in bowl of electric mixer until light and fluffy. Add sugar; beat until combined. Mix in flour, pecans and salt.
- Shape dough into 1-inch ovals, tapering one end. Bake 15 minutes. Remove from oven; insert noodle at tail end and 2 almonds about 1/3 of the way from pointed end for ears. Return to oven; bake until slightly browned, about 12 minutes.
- Remove from oven; immediately place 2 chocolate chips in front of ears for eyes. (Chocolate will melt slightly and stick to cookie.) Dust mice bodies with confectioners’ sugar. Cool on wire rack.
